111243144031 has 2 divisors, whose sum is σ = 111243144032. Its totient is φ = 111243144030.
The previous prime is 111243143993. The next prime is 111243144043. The reversal of 111243144031 is 130441342111.
It is a strong prime.
It is a cyclic number.
It is not a de Polignac number, because 111243144031 - 211 = 111243141983 is a prime.
It is a super-2 number, since 2×1112431440312 (a number of 23 digits) contains 22 as substring.
It is a junction number, because it is equal to n+sod(n) for n = 111243143987 and 111243144005.
It is a congruent number.
It is not a weakly prime, because it can be changed into another prime (111243144731) by changing a digit.
It is a polite number, since it can be written as a sum of consecutive naturals, namely, 55621572015 + 55621572016.
It is an arithmetic number, because the mean of its divisors is an integer number (55621572016).
Almost surely, 2111243144031 is an apocalyptic number.
111243144031 is a deficient number, since it is larger than the sum of its proper divisors (1).
111243144031 is an equidigital number, since it uses as much as digits as its factorization.
111243144031 is an evil number, because the sum of its binary digits is even.
The product of its (nonzero) digits is 1152, while the sum is 25.
Adding to 111243144031 its reverse (130441342111), we get a palindrome (241684486142).
